1970 Chevrolet Comodoro vs. 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ata

To start off, 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ro would be higher. At 2,470 cc (4 cylinders), 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ata (137 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 58 more horse power than 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ro. (79 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ata should accelerate faster than 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ro weights approximately 90 kg more than 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ata.

Let's talk about torque, 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ro (165 Nm @ 2500 RPM) has 2 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ata. (163 Nm @ 5000 RPM). This means 1970 Chevrolet Comodoro will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ata.

Compare all specifications:

1970 Chevrolet Comodoro 1999 Mazda MX-5 Miata
Make Chevrolet Mazda
Model Comodoro MX-5 Miata
Year Released 1970 1999
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2470 cc 1840 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 79 HP 137 HP
Engine RPM 4400 RPM 6500 RPM
Torque 165 Nm 163 Nm
Torque RPM 2500 RPM 5000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Vehicle Weight 1120 kg 1030 kg
Vehicle Length 4720 mm 3980 mm
Vehicle Width 1770 mm 1690 mm
Vehicle Height 1390 mm 1230 mm
Wheelbase Size 2670 mm 2300 mm
